A circular disc X of radius R is made from an iron plate of thickness t, and another disc Y of radius 4R is made from an iron plate of thickness t/4. Then the relation between the moment of inertia Iₓ and I_y is

  1. I_y = 32 Iₓ
  2. I_y = 16 Iₓ
  3. I_y = Iₓ
  4. I_y = 64 Iₓ

Correct answer: I_y = 64 Iₓ

Solution

The moment of inertia for a disc is proportional to its mass and the square of its radius. Disc Y, having a radius 4R and a thickness t/4, has a mass that scales with the volume, resulting in a factor of 16 increase due to the radius squared and an additional factor of 4 due to the thickness, leading to a total increase of 64 times the moment of inertia of disc X.
